What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Flutter Develop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Flutter Developer, you need solid programming skills in Dart, understanding of mobile app architecture, and experience with cross-platform development, often backed by a degree in computer science or related fields. Familiarity with tools like Android Studio, Xcode, Git, and CI/CD systems, as well as experience publishing apps to the App Store and Google Play, is typically required. Strong problem-solving abilities, collaboration, and effective communication set standout developers apart. These skills ensure high-quality, maintainable apps and smooth integration within teams and development workflows, which is critical for delivering successful mobile solutions.

What are some common challenges faced by Flutter Developers who relocate for a new role, and how can they prepare for a smooth transition?

Flutter Developers who relocate for a position often encounter challenges such as adapting to a new workplace culture, adjusting to different development processes, and navigating logistics like housing and local laws. To ensure a smooth transition, it's helpful to communicate early with your new team, familiarize yourself with the company's tech stack and workflow, and seek out local developer communities for support. Many employers provide relocation assistance and onboarding resources, so don't hesitate to ask about these during the hiring process.

What does a Relocation Available Flutter Developer do?

A Relocation Available Flutter Developer is a software developer who specializes in building mobile applications using the Flutter framework and is open to moving to a new location for work. Their primary responsibility is to design, develop, test, and maintain cross-platform mobile apps for both Android and iOS devices. In addition to strong coding skills in Dart (the language used by Flutter), they often collaborate with designers and backend developers to deliver seamless user experiences. Being open to relocation means they are willing to move to a different city or country as required by their employer.
